The 420 mm rotor sets the minimum wheel size at 21" — smaller wheels will not clear the caliper and rotor. Spoke profile and offset also affect clearance; confirm your exact wheels before ordering.

Wheel Size (Standard) Disc Range
15" 260 mm – 285 mm
16" 285 mm – 300 mm
17" 300 mm – 330 mm
18" 330 mm – 355 mm
19" 355 mm – 380 mm
20" 380 mm – 400 mm
21" 400 mm – 420 mm
22" 420 mm – 440 mm

Why Carbon Ceramic — and Why StopFlex

Premium Ceramic-Glaze Finish

StopFlex's proprietary coating gives the disc a bright ceramic-glaze surface with subtle texture — the factory carbon-ceramic look, clearly visible through open wheel designs.

Continuous Fiber Construction

StopFlex discs are built with long continuous carbon fiber instead of chopped short fiber. Continuous strands carry load across the whole rotor body, raising strength and thermal durability under heat cycles.

Bespoke Per-Vehicle Engineering

Every order is machined to the confirmed vehicle and trim. Brackets, hat offsets, and pad shapes are built for that exact car — never pulled from a one-size-fits-all catalog.

CCB-Specific Pad Compound

A low-metallic resin pad compound reinforced with steel, copper, and aramid fiber, made for ceramic discs: stable to about 750 °C, roughly 0.44 average friction, strong fade resistance, low rotor wear.

Lower Unsprung Mass

A carbon-ceramic rotor weighs roughly half of the equivalent iron disc. Less rotating, unsprung mass lets the suspension follow broken pavement more cleanly and makes steering response noticeably sharper.

High-Temperature Stability

The carbon-silicon-carbide friction matrix keeps working at temperatures that push iron rotors into heavy fade, so the tenth hard stop feels like the first — same pedal travel, same bite point.

Rust-Free Rotor Surface

Ceramic discs cannot flash-rust. After rain, a wash, or weeks of parking, the rotor face behind your open-spoke wheels stays clean — no orange ring on a freshly detailed car.

Long Street-Service Life

In normal road use with matched pads and correct bedding, one StopFlex CCB rotor set is engineered to outlast several sets of iron replacement rotors, recovering part of the up-front cost.

Low Visible Dust

Matched with StopFlex pads, the system sheds a fraction of the dust an iron rotor and pad combination throws. Wheels stay clean for weeks of driving instead of days.

Winter & Cold-Weather Braking

A cold, untuned carbon-ceramic disc needs more pedal than iron on the first winter stops — normal material physics. StopFlex engineered the pad formula and disc coating specifically for cold starts, closing that gap: cold-car winter feel is now very close to summer feel. Keep a little extra distance on the coldest mornings; for harsh winters, choose Street Spec.

Choose Your Rotor: Street, Track-Day, or Motorsport

StopFlex Street Spec carbon ceramic brake rotor

Street Spec

Ceramic coating, cross-drilled face, and large cooling channels.

Best for daily driving and premium street builds that need clean cold bite, low dust, corrosion-free appearance, and long service life.

StopFlex Track-Day Spec carbon ceramic brake rotor

Track-Day Spec

Ceramic coating, blank face, and honeycomb cooling channels.

Best for fast-road and track-day use where repeated braking stability matters more than maximum visual drilling style.

StopFlex Motorsport Spec carbon ceramic brake rotor

Motorsport Spec

Uncoated blank face with honeycomb cooling channels.

Best for race-focused builds that run competition pads, high-temperature fluid, cooling strategy, and a proper warm-up window. Not the default street choice.

Heat Management Note

Ceramic discs shrug off surface temperatures that would destroy iron, but the rest of the system still heats up: pads, fluid, seals, calipers, and wheels all absorb soak heat during repeated hard stops. For track days, long descents, and sustained hard driving, run brake cooling and high-temperature fluid.
